What is an orchestra without a conductor? The conductorless orchestra, sometimes referred to as a self-conducted orchestra or unconducted orchestra, is an instrumental ensemble that functions as an orchestra but is not led or directed by a conductor. Most conductorless orchestras are smaller in size, and generally perform chamber orchestra repertoire.

Do conductors stay a beat ahead?

So, beating ahead gives the musicians the chance to follow the conductor’s instructions with a bit of warning. … Yet amateur orchestra conductors tend more typically to conduct on the beat, to act as a clear metronome for the musicians (Bernstein wouldn’t like it, but hey-ho, it’s good to be in time).

Is bone a good conductor of electricity?

Human bones consist chiefly of calcium phosphate, this is a form of salt which dissolves poorly (they’re solid inside your body). Since salts don’t conduct in their solid state due to lack of electrons which can flow freely, bones do not conduct.

How does a conductor change an electric field?

A conductor placed in an electric field will be polarized. … Free charges move within the conductor, polarizing it, until the electric field lines are perpendicular to the surface. The field lines end on excess negative charge on one section of the surface and begin again on excess positive charge on the opposite side.

Can a conductor be charged by induction?

Only conductors can be charged by the induction process. The process relies on the fact that a charged object can force or induce the movement of electrons about the material being charged. The object being charged ends up with a charge which is the opposite of the object being used to charge it.

What are good conductors of heat called?

Materials that are good conductors of thermal energy are called thermal conductors. Metals are very good thermal conductors. Materials that are poor conductors of thermal energy are called thermal insulators. Gases such as air and materials such as plastic and wood are thermal insulators.

What is the stick used by an orchestra conductor called?

A baton is a stick that is used by conductors primarily to enlarge and enhance the manual and bodily movements associated with directing an ensemble of musicians.

Is aluminum chloride a good conductor?

Solid aluminum chloride does not conduct electricity at room temperature because the ions are not free to move. Molten aluminum chloride (only possible at increased pressures) is also nonconductive, because it has lost its ionic character.

Are plastics good conductors of heat?

Why is plastic a good insulator? Plastics are poor heat conductors, because they have virtually no free electrons available for conduction mechanisms like metals. The thermal insulating capacity of plastics is rated by measuring the thermal conductivity.
